Teen Titans Go! - Season 1

Season 1

Episodes

Legendary Sandwich
Raven sends the Titans to the ends of the universe on a quest for the ingredients to make a legendary, magical sandwich.

Pie Bros
Cyborg's birthday is coming up, Beast Boy takes a job at their favorite pie shop so he can afford an expensive gift.

Driver's Ed
Robin gets his driver's license suspended after wrecking the Batmobile, and must take a Driver's Ed course.

Dog Hand
Raven's demon father, Trigon, comes to visit, and wins over her friends in an effort to get her to embrace dark magic and become evil like him.

Double Trouble
Cyborg tricks Raven to create a magical double of himself and Beast Boy so they will both always have someone to play with.

The Date
Robin gets up the courage to ask Starfire on a date, only to find that she has already agreed to go out with Speedy.

Dude Relax
The team places Robin on forced hiatus while Beast Boy teaches him to relax after his high-strung nature begins affecting the team. Robin attempts to learn how to be lazy.

Laundry Day
It's laundry day, but Robin makes Raven do the chore. But problems begin to arise if the Titans don't have their suits.

Ghostboy
Beast Boy has been pranking the other Titans a lot, so the they decide to give him a taste of his own medicine.

La Larva de Amor
The gang agrees to take on the responsibility of babysitting Silkie while Starfire is away, but they end up losing him while he ends up having an exciting telenovela adventure in Mexico.

Hey Pizza!
Cyborg and Beast Boy want to get a pizza in over 30 minutes so that their pizza would be free of charge, but the delivery boy is seemingly unstoppable. It is becoming a bit of a challenge, and an all-out war of wits between them starts. Meanwhile, Robin struggles to decide whether to build a senior center or a pool.

Gorilla
Beast Boy has turned into a loud, obnoxious gorilla and refuses to change back, driving Robin crazy. Gorilla Beast Boy takes over the leadership of the Titans, leading to chaos, so Cyborg teaches Robin how to become an alpha male so he can reclaim his role as leader of the Teen Titans.

Super Robin
Sick of being the only member of the team without any superpowers, Robin thinks he is ready for some powers of his own. Raven warns him that powers can be a curse.

Tower Power
When Cyborg malfunctions, the Titans decide to plug him into the tower, giving him full access to all of the systems.

Parasite
When Starfire picks up a space parasite she decides to keep it, thinking it's harmless, but Robin believes it may be evil.
